草庐IT

Windows下SqlServer2008通过ODBC连接到DM数据库安装部署

 1环境说明操作系统:WindowsServer2008数据库版本:SQLServer200810.50.1600.12搭建过程2.1达梦数据库软件下载进入达梦官网https://www.dameng.com/选择X86,win64,点击下载。2.2安装数据库解压下载后文件,进入iso执行setup.exe按默认一直往下点这里选自定义,勾选驱动定义安装路径点击安装安装完成后在安装根目录下有drivers文件夹,这里面是我们要的驱动文件安装前的odbc里面是没有DM驱动的安装后就有了2.3通过odbc增加DM数据源2.4配置DM数据库相关信息2.5在SqlServer客户端里创建链接服务器选错了

c# - NHibernate.Spatial 和 Sql 2008 地理类型 - 如何配置

我正在尝试将Nhibernate与Sql2008地理类型一起使用,但遇到了困难。我正在使用FluentNhibernate来配置我对它相当陌生,所以这也可能是问题所在。首先,我要坚持的类(class)看起来像这样:publicclassLocationLog:FluentNHibernate.Data.Entity{publicvirtualnewintId{get;set;}publicvirtualDateTimeTimeStamp{get;set;}publicvirtualGisSharpBlog.NetTopologySuite.Geometries.PointLocatio

c# - NHibernate.Spatial 和 Sql 2008 地理类型 - 如何配置

我正在尝试将Nhibernate与Sql2008地理类型一起使用,但遇到了困难。我正在使用FluentNhibernate来配置我对它相当陌生,所以这也可能是问题所在。首先,我要坚持的类(class)看起来像这样:publicclassLocationLog:FluentNHibernate.Data.Entity{publicvirtualnewintId{get;set;}publicvirtualDateTimeTimeStamp{get;set;}publicvirtualGisSharpBlog.NetTopologySuite.Geometries.PointLocatio

c# - 如何将 XML 从 C# 传递到 SQL Server 2008 中的存储过程?

我想将xml文档传递给sqlserver存储过程,如下所示:CREATEPROCEDUREBookDetails_Insert(@xmlxml)我想将一些字段数据与其他表数据进行比较,如果匹配,则记录必须插入到表中。要求:如何将XML传递给存储过程?我试过这个,但它不起作用:[Working]command.Parameters.Add(newSqlParameter("@xml",SqlDbType.Xml){Value=newSqlXml(newXmlTextReader(xmlToSave.InnerXml,XmlNodeType.Document,null))});如何访问存储

c# - 如何将 XML 从 C# 传递到 SQL Server 2008 中的存储过程?

我想将xml文档传递给sqlserver存储过程,如下所示:CREATEPROCEDUREBookDetails_Insert(@xmlxml)我想将一些字段数据与其他表数据进行比较,如果匹配,则记录必须插入到表中。要求:如何将XML传递给存储过程?我试过这个,但它不起作用:[Working]command.Parameters.Add(newSqlParameter("@xml",SqlDbType.Xml){Value=newSqlXml(newXmlTextReader(xmlToSave.InnerXml,XmlNodeType.Document,null))});如何访问存储

c# - VS2008 - 为调试/发布配置输出不同的文件名

使用VisualStudio2008构建C#应用程序时,是否可以为每个配置设置不同的输出文件名?e.g.MyApp_Debug.exeMyApp_Release.exe我尝试了一个构建后步骤,通过附加当前配置来重命名文件,但这似乎是一种草率的方法。此外,这意味着VisualStudio在按F5开始调试时无法再找到该文件。 最佳答案 您可以通过手动编辑项目文件来实现这一点。找到节点并向其添加条件属性:MyApp_Debug.exeMyApp_Release.exe您还必须复制它以便为发布版本添加另一个条件属性。虽然这是可能的,但它可能

c# - VS2008 - 为调试/发布配置输出不同的文件名

使用VisualStudio2008构建C#应用程序时,是否可以为每个配置设置不同的输出文件名?e.g.MyApp_Debug.exeMyApp_Release.exe我尝试了一个构建后步骤,通过附加当前配置来重命名文件,但这似乎是一种草率的方法。此外,这意味着VisualStudio在按F5开始调试时无法再找到该文件。 最佳答案 您可以通过手动编辑项目文件来实现这一点。找到节点并向其添加条件属性:MyApp_Debug.exeMyApp_Release.exe您还必须复制它以便为发布版本添加另一个条件属性。虽然这是可能的,但它可能

c# - Visual Studio 2008 锁定自定义 MSBuild 任务程序集

我正在开发一个构建ORMlayer的自定义MSBuild任务,并在项目中使用它。我受到VisualStudio坚持MSBuild任务DLL而不放手的行为的阻碍。我想这样组织我的解决方案;MySolution|+-(1)ORMLayerCustomTaskProject|||+-BuildOrmLayerTask.cs//here'smytask|+-(2)BusinessLogicProject//andhere'stheprojectthatusesit.|+-但是,当项目(2)生成时,它会锁定到项目(1)的程序集。所以现在我无法在不关闭解决方案并重新打开它的情况下再次构建项目(1)

c# - Visual Studio 2008 锁定自定义 MSBuild 任务程序集

我正在开发一个构建ORMlayer的自定义MSBuild任务,并在项目中使用它。我受到VisualStudio坚持MSBuild任务DLL而不放手的行为的阻碍。我想这样组织我的解决方案;MySolution|+-(1)ORMLayerCustomTaskProject|||+-BuildOrmLayerTask.cs//here'smytask|+-(2)BusinessLogicProject//andhere'stheprojectthatusesit.|+-但是,当项目(2)生成时,它会锁定到项目(1)的程序集。所以现在我无法在不关闭解决方案并重新打开它的情况下再次构建项目(1)

c# - 如何在 Visual Studio 2008 中为简单的 Windows 窗体应用程序插入下拉菜单?

似乎还有各种其他类型的下拉菜单——那些允许用户输入的,那些只允许输入整数的,那些不……下拉的,甚至那些旁边有难看的复选框的.我只想要一个简单的下拉菜单(就像我在html中使用的一样),让用户只选择一个项目。(并且默认选择一个)有什么想法吗?这应该非常简单,但我花了一个半小时才弄明白... 最佳答案 您可以使用ComboBox并将其ComboBoxStyle(在以后的版本中显示为DropDownStyle)设置为DropDownList.请参阅:http://msdn.microsoft.com/en-us/library/syste